Study Title | The metabolomic resetting effect of FG4592 in AKI to CKD transition (Part 1) |
Study Summary | C57BL/6 mice were anesthetized using isoflurane. UIR was induced by clamping the right renal pedicle for 45 minutes and then releasing it to allow reperfusion, leaving the left kidney intact. Sham treated mice served as controls. Each mouse was located supine on a thermostatic pad (37 °C) to maintain its body temperature throughout the whole process. After 3 days of recovery, the mice received a daily intraperitoneal (i.p.) injection of FG4592 (10 mg/kg) or vehicle for 18 consecutive days. After treatment, the mice were sacrificed. Non-target metabolomics analysis was carried out using the kidney tissues of mice sacrificed at day 21 after UIR. |

Sample Preparation:
Sampleprep ID: | SP001938 |
Sampleprep Summary: | 20 mg of each tissue sample were homogenized with 0.6 mL of 2 chloro phenylalanine (4 ppm) containing methanol (−20 °C), centrifuged, and filtered through a 0.22-μm membrane |
